DVD FEATURES

(2 Disk Collector's Edition)

16:9 Anamorphic Widescreen Presentation (2.35:1 Aspect Ratio).
Optional subtitles in 11 languages - English, Spanish, Hebrew, Arabic, Dutch, Gujarati, Bengali, Tamil, Telugu, Kannada and Malayalam.
Original 5.1 Dolby Digital Sound.
Digitally re-mastered from the original film.
Feature Film Running Time: Approximately 192 minutes.

Over 90 minutes of exciting additional material, as detailed below:
The Making of the Songs: An Exclusive "behind the scenes" look at the creation of the songs of Veer-Zaara.

Karan Johar in conversation with Yash Chopra on Veer-Zaara.
Glimpses from the Veer-Zaara Premiere: Exclusive highlights from the grand premiere of Veer-Zaara, attended by the who's who of the Indian film industry.

Deleted Scenes: Exclusive "never-seen-before" deleted scenes from the film, presented with optional English subtitles in 16 x 9 Anamorphic Aspect Ratio.

Deleted Song: "YEH HUM AA GAYE HAIN KAHAAN" - An Exclusive "first look" at the deleted song from the film, with 5.1 Dolby Digital sound in 16 x 9 Anamorphic Aspect Ratio.
(Option 1 - The Song, Option 2 - The song as in the film's screenplay)

Television Promos: A look at all the Television promos of Veer-Zaara.

Original Theatrical Trailor: Presented in 16 x 9 Anamorphic Aspect Ratio with 5.1 Dolby Digital sound.

Here is the cover of the official YASHRAJ Veer Zaara Songs VCD

Image

VCD Features:

VCD Format: PAL

Contains only songs from the movie Veer-Zaara (no sub-titles)

Single VCD Disc packed in a special hard box, and not in a usual card/paper sleeve

Digitally re-mastered from the original film
